If you're purchasing an auto with money, examine your bank accounts and determine the total price you can fairly pay for to pay. If you're purchasing a cars and truck with an auto financing, contrast your present regular monthly expenditures to your earnings and find out the regular monthly automobile payment you can afford. Utilize the Edmunds vehicle lending calculator to estimate the vehicle payment and car loan quantity needed based on the price of an automobile.


Keep in mind, you'll likewise spend for the car registration, taxes and fees, so expect to pay more. Don't forget to think about the size of the down settlement you can manage. You'll pay that upfront. When determining your budget, include various other car owner expenses like gas, upkeep, vehicle insurance policy and repair services.


Moving over your old financing right into your new one implies remaining to spend for (and pay interest on) an auto you're no longer utilizing. You might be able to obtain more money for your old car by marketing it privately over trading it in. Make use of the money towards your down settlement.

FYI: The sticker price isn't the overall cost of the vehicle it's simply the maker's recommended list price (MSRP). Bear in mind those taxes and fees we said you'll have to pay when purchasing an auto? Those are consisted of (in addition to the MSRP) in what's called the out-the-door rate. So why discuss based on the out-the-door cost? Dealers can expand funding payment terms to hit your target monthly payment while not decreasing the out-the-door price, and you'll finish up paying even more passion in the lengthy run.


Both you and the dealer are entitled to a reasonable offer yet you'll likely wind up paying a bit greater than you desire and the dealership will likely obtain a little much less than they want - mazda cx-30 dealer near me. Always begin negotiations by asking what the out-the-door price is and go from there. If the supplier isn't going low sufficient, you might have the ability to negotiate some details items to obtain closer to your wanted price

It's a what-you-see-is-what-you-pay kind of cost. Just due to the fact that you have actually negotiated a bargain doesn't indicate you're home-free. You'll likely be offered add-on options, like elegant modern technology packages, interior upgrades, prolonged guarantees, gap insurance policy and various other defense strategies. Ask yourself if the add-on is something you genuinely require prior to concurring, as the majority of these offers can be included at a later day if you pick.


If you determine to acquire an add-on, negotiate that cost, as well. Lenders may need space insurance policy with brand-new vehicles, but you don't have to finance it through the supplier. Acquisition it from your car insurer or shop around for rates. Vehicles are a major purchase, and you do not wish to regret purchasing one preparation is essential!
